mirror of
https://gitee.com/xia-chu/ZLMediaKit.git
synced 2026-05-16 23:07:49 +08:00
修复某些不规范流不注册的问题
This commit is contained in:
parent
cffd98042b
commit
0bbcbb9907
@ -37,6 +37,10 @@ bool MediaSink::addTrack(const Track::Ptr &track_in) {
|
|||||||
WarnL << "All track is ready, add track too late: " << track_in->getCodecName();
|
WarnL << "All track is ready, add track too late: " << track_in->getCodecName();
|
||||||
return false;
|
return false;
|
||||||
}
|
}
|
||||||
|
if (_track_map.size() >= _max_track_size) {
|
||||||
|
WarnL << "Max track size reached: " << _max_track_size << ", add track ignored:" << track_in->getCodecName();
|
||||||
|
return false;
|
||||||
|
}
|
||||||
// 克隆Track,只拷贝其数据,不拷贝其数据转发关系 [AUTO-TRANSLATED:09edaa31]
|
// 克隆Track,只拷贝其数据,不拷贝其数据转发关系 [AUTO-TRANSLATED:09edaa31]
|
||||||
// Clone Track, only copy its data, not its data forwarding relationship
|
// Clone Track, only copy its data, not its data forwarding relationship
|
||||||
auto track = track_in->clone();
|
auto track = track_in->clone();
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user